About the role

The Warehouse Associate plays a crucial role in supporting Emmi Roth's production activities by operating forklifts and other material handling equipment, ensuring accurate and timely order fulfillment, and maintaining a clean and organized work environment.

Responsibilities

  • Operates forklifts and other material handling equipment to load and unload trucks, move products, and transport materials within the facility.
  • Safely and efficiently stacks and stores materials in designated areas to optimize space utilization.
  • Performs routine inspections of forklifts and equipment to ensure they are in good working condition.
  • Adheres to all safety protocols and guidelines to prevent accidents, injuries, and product damage.
  • Picks orders and ensures accurate and timely fulfillment of customer requests.
  • Operates forklifts to retrieve bulk pallets of food products from designated storage areas.
  • Verifies product quality and quantity, ensuring that correct items are picked for each order.
  • Securely wraps and prepares pallets for shipment, following proper packaging guidelines.
  • Loads and unloads pallets onto trucks in a safe and efficient manner.
  • Maintains accurate inventory records by updating stock movements, counts, and locations in the warehouse management system.
  • Conducts regular cycle counts and assists in physical inventory counts as required.
  • Identifies and reports any inventory discrepancies, damaged products, or quality issues to the appropriate supervisor.
  • Maintains a clean and organized work area, including aisles, shelves, and storage locations.
  • Assists in receiving and inspecting incoming shipments, ensuring accuracy and quality.
  • Collaborates with other team members to fulfill ad-hoc tasks and support overall warehouse operations.

Qualifications, Skills, Education and/or Experience

  • Ability to complete forklift operator certification and demonstrate proficiency in operating forklifts and other material handling equipment.
  • Prior experience working in a food manufacturing facility or refrigerated warehouse is preferred.
  • Strong attention to detail and the ability to accurately follow instructions and pick orders according to specifications.
  • Excellent organizational skills with the ability to prioritize tasks and meet deadlines.
  • Physical stamina and the ability to lift heavy objects (up to 50 pounds) and work in a refrigerated environment.
  • Basic computer skills for data entry and inventory management.
  • Strong commitment to workplace safety and knowledge of warehouse safety regulations.
